volume, contain the fpace of thirty-fix years; the reign of the former including twenty-four, and that of the latter, twelve. They extend from the first year of the CVth Olympiad, or the year of the world 3644, to the first year of the CXIVth Olympiad, which anfwers to the year of the world 3680.

The kings who reigned during that time in Perfia, were, Artaxerxes Ochus, Arfes, and Darius Codomannus. The Perfian empire expired with the laft.

We know not any thing concerning the tranfactions of the Jews during thefe thirty-fix years, except what we are told by Jofephus, book xi. chap. 7. and 8. of his Antiquities of the Jews, under the highpriefts John or Johanan, and Jaddus. Thefe will be mentioned in the courfe of this hiftory, with which that of the Jews is intermixed.

The above-mentioned fpace of thirty-fix years (with refpect to the Roman hiftory) extends from the 393d to the 429th year from the foundation of Rome. The great men, who made the most confpicuous figure among the Romans during that fpace of time, were Appius Claudius the dictator, T. Quinctius Capitolinus, Tit. Manlius Torquatus, L. Papirius Curfor, M. Valerius Cornivus, Q. Fabius Maximus, and the two Decii, who devoted themfelves to death for the fake of their country.
